ALPHA-THROMBIN COMPLEX WITH SULFATED HIRUDIN (RESIDUES 54-65) AND L-ARGININE TEMPLATE INHIBITOR CS107

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 16294249

About this Structure

1W7G is a 3 chains structure of sequences from Homo sapiens.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.

Reference

  • Salvagnini C, Michaux C, Remiche J, Wouters J, Charlier P, Marchand-Brynaert J. Design, synthesis and evaluation of graftable thrombin inhibitors for the preparation of blood-compatible polymer materials. Org Biomol Chem. 2005 Dec 7;3(23):4209-20. Epub 2005 Oct 19. PMID:16294249 doi:10.1039/b510239a
